Output eec413434b114ca32fe3a04c6a65456660e93a28341b6a000ef81ee6ceb0585b:0

value
6971433995662
script pubkey
OP_0 OP_PUSHBYTES_20 41df4414062ce40b5090c295c137aaedc43581c6
address
tb1qg805g9qx9njqk5ysc22uzda2ahzrtqwxpv9kvx
transaction
eec413434b114ca32fe3a04c6a65456660e93a28341b6a000ef81ee6ceb0585b
confirmations
190545
spent
true